Haedropleura hanleyi is a species of sea snail, a marine gastropod mollusk in the family Horaiclavidae.
It was previously included within the family Turridae. [2]
It is species inquirenda. [3] It is spurious taxon, of which no types could be traced and it may be a species of Propebela . [3]
This species occurs in the English Channel off France.
